North West Cricket honoured its top players, coaches, umpires and scorers during a glittering 2021/22 awards ceremony held at the Madiba Banquet Hall in Potchefstroom on Friday, 9 September.
The big winners on the night were the men’s and women’s Dragons players of the year. All-rounder, Senuran Muthusamy won the NW Dragons men’s Player of the Year award, whilst Tazmin Brits won the NW Dragons Women Player of the Year award.
Muthusamy also picked up the NW Dragons men’s Bowler of the Year award in his first season as a Dragons player.
Wesley Marshall was named at the NW Dragons Batsman of the Year, whilst the Players Player of the Year award goes to the experienced Heino Kuhn, who will also captain the side this season. Kuhn deputises for Nicky van den Bergh, who is still recovering from an injury.

The NW Dragons women’s team was also honoured on stage after winning the CSA Women’s 50 over title this past season.
Women’s cricket and its continuous development is definitely one of North West Cricket’s strong points. 17-year-old Elandri Janse van Rensburg won numerous awards on the night including the u.19 Women’s Player of the Year and NW Dragons women Bowler of the Year.
Former NW Dragons women’s coach, Wynand Schmitt was also awarded with the Coach of the Year award.
The Scorer of the Year award went to Karabo Nkagisang. The Umpire of the Year award was won by Adele Louw.
NWU I was awarded as winners of the NW Club Cricket Premier League. Chris Britz (NWU captain) was also awarded as the NW Academy Player of the Year.
